Black and white photograph of the Animas River and the broken down D. & R.G. R.R. Bridge. Writing on front states, "The section of the D.& R.G. R.R. Bridge that was washed away by the Animas River. Flood of 1911."

Photograph of the right side of narrow gauge engine #453, in the Durango station. Postcard is addressed to Mrs. Alta Landrum of Waco, Texas, and is dated 6-30-54. A duplicate of this postcard was postmarked 9-16-1949 on the Alamosa & Durango Train #216.
